DID YOU KNOW?
- Social work is one of the top ranked occupations for projected growth in job opportunities.
- The U.S. News and World Report has selected social work as a top career choice for the past several years.
- It is expected, as a result of current surveys, that the job market for social workers will be picking up considerably through 2008.
- Employment for social workers is expected to increase faster than the average for all occupations through 2010.
- Social work is a versatile degree allowing individuals to work in a broad range of practice areas.
- More job opportunities are available than ever before.
- Licensure for social workers at three different levels: bachelor's level (RSW); master's level (GSW); and three years post master's (LCSW).
- Over 240 different areas have been identified for social work practice.
- Professional social workers are the nation's largest group of mental health services providers.
- Social work graduates are successful in securing employment and in graduate school.
